Dorothy Lathrop


Just a few images from the artist Dorothy Lathrop. She worked predominantly throughout the 1930's-1940's, and liked drawing animals and fairies most. Actually she was most attracted to stories that involved "fiercer" animals or beasts, but was discouraged from drawing them so as to not scare the children, haha. I love how she did both ink and watercolour drawings so perfectly!
